Features:
!
High reliability method of
interconnecting.
!
Reliable mechanical support.
!
Complete flexibility. If the board to
board spacing you need is not shown
on pages 54 - 55 , consult factory.
Terminals and Contacts:
Terminal: Brass - Copper Alloy 360,
ASTM-B-16
Contact: Beryllium Copper - Copper
Alloy 172, ASTM-B-194
Plating:
Terminal: Gold over Nickel or
Tin-Lead over Nickel
Contact: Gold over Nickel or
Tin-Lead over Nickel
Body Material:
Molded -
Glass filled thermoplastic
Polyester (P
.B.T.) U.L. Rated 94V-O,
-60
°
C to 140
°
C (-76
°
F to 284
°
F)
High Temp Molded
- High temp. glass
filled thermoplastic, U.L. Rated 94V-O,
-60
°
C to 260
°
C (-76
°
F to 500
°
F)
Peel-A-Way
®
- Polyimide Film - Temp.
range -269
°
C to 400
°
C(-452
°
F to 752
°
F)
